Why Do Traditional Lead-Acid Batteries Fall Short for Stand Up Reach Forklifts?

Lead-acid batteries demand frequent watering and venting, risking spills that halt operations for hours. Their 1,000-cycle limit means replacements every 18-24 months, costing $5,000-$10,000 per unit annually including labor. Deep discharges below 50% cut runtime by 40%, stranding lifts mid-shift in tight aisles.

Maintenance alone consumes 15% of technician time, per Material Handling Industry reports. Compared to lithium options, lead-acid units weigh 30% more, reducing payload capacity and straining forklift masts during high reaches. These shortcomings amplify downtime in 24/7 environments.
